弹性资源如何实现高性能和低延迟的服务响应?

弹性资源在现代计算环境中扮演着至关重要的角色,尤其是在需要应对不断变化的工作负载和需求的情况下,实现高性能和低延迟的服务响应是构建高效弹性资源系统的关键目标,本文将探讨如何通过各种技术手段和管理策略来实现这一目标。

自动化的资源管理

弹性资源如何实现高性能和低延迟的服务响应?

自动化是提升资源弹性的基石,通过自动化工具和平台,可以实现资源的快速分配、扩展和回收,从而满足应用的性能要求,使用容器化技术(如Docker)和编排工具(如Kubernetes),可以自动地在不同的主机上部署、扩展和迁移应用服务。

微服务架构

微服务架构通过将应用拆分成一系列小型、独立的服务来提高系统的弹性,每个微服务都可以独立扩展,这样可以根据实际需求动态调整资源,而不是为整个应用分配统一的资源池,这种方法有助于减少资源浪费,同时提高服务的响应速度。

负载均衡

负载均衡器可以将流量分散到多个服务器或服务实例上,确保没有任何一个点过载,这不仅可以提高性能,还能在发生故障时保持服务的可用性,现代负载均衡器通常具备智能路由功能,能够根据实时性能指标和健康检查来指导流量。

缓存策略

缓存是提高服务响应速度的有效手段,通过在内存中存储经常访问的数据,可以减少对后端存储系统的查询次数,从而降低延迟,使用分布式缓存系统(如Redis或Memcached)可以在多个服务实例之间共享缓存数据,进一步提高效率。

弹性资源如何实现高性能和低延迟的服务响应?

数据库优化

数据库是许多服务的重要组成部分,优化数据库配置和查询可以显著提高性能,使用索引、分区和复制等技术可以加快查询速度并提高数据的可用性,选择适合特定工作负载的数据库类型(如关系型数据库、NoSQL数据库或新型数据库如NewSQL)也至关重要。

网络优化

网络延迟是影响服务响应时间的关键因素之一,优化网络配置,比如使用更快的网络连接、减少网络跳数、采用内容分发网络(CDN)等,可以显著减少数据传输时间,使用网络虚拟化技术可以更灵活地管理网络资源,提高整体效率。

监控和分析

持续监控服务的性能指标对于及时发现和解决问题至关重要,使用监控工具(如Prometheus、Grafana或ELK Stack)可以帮助收集和分析数据,从而识别瓶颈和异常行为,基于这些数据,可以做出更加精确的资源调度决策。

灾难恢复和备份

弹性资源如何实现高性能和低延迟的服务响应?

为了确保服务的高可用性,必须制定有效的灾难恢复计划和备份策略,这包括定期备份数据、在多个地理位置部署服务副本以及测试恢复流程,这样,在发生故障时,可以迅速恢复服务,最小化对用户的影响。

相关问题与解答

Q1: 如何在不牺牲性能的情况下实现成本效益?

A1: 实现成本效益的同时不牺牲性能,可以通过多种方式:采用按需付费模式,只在必要时扩展资源;优化资源使用,避免过度配置;再次,实施自动化脚本来关闭未使用的资源;定期审查和优化服务架构,以消除不必要的复杂性和开销。

Q2: 在多租户环境下如何确保资源隔离和服务质量?

A2: 在多租户环境中,资源隔离是确保服务质量的关键,可以通过虚拟化技术实现物理资源的隔离,确保每个租户有独立的计算、存储和网络资源,使用容器和微服务架构可以进一步隔离应用和服务,还可以通过配额和服务水平协议(SLA)来管理资源使用和服务质量。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/289055.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-02-05 10:49
Next 2024-02-05 10:51

相关推荐

  • 微信小程序代理价格

    小程序代理价格因需求、功能复杂度和开发公司而异,需具体询价。

    2024-02-06
    0117
  • 云更新服务器系统

    云更新服务器系统是一种通过云计算技术实现的远程服务器系统更新方法,可以提高安全性和效率。

    2024-04-01
    0149
  • cdn和流媒体一样吗

    CDN和流媒体是两个不同的概念,但它们在某些方面有相似之处,本文将详细介绍CDN和流媒体的区别,以及它们之间的联系。CDN(内容分发网络)与流媒体的区别1、CDN是一种网络技术,它通过将网站的内容分发到全球各地的服务器上,使用户能够从离他们最近的服务器获取内容,从而提高访问速度和稳定性,CDN主要关注的是静态资源,如图片、视频、CSS……

    2023-12-12
    0113
  • 如何在Android开发中连接数据库?

    在Android开发中,连接数据库是一项常见且重要的任务,无论是本地的SQLite数据库,还是远程的MySQL数据库,开发者都需要掌握相关的技能,本文将详细介绍如何在Android应用中连接MySQL数据库,并提供一些实用的技巧和示例代码,一、准备工作1. 安装MySQL数据库确保你的MySQL数据库已经安装并……

    2024-11-03
    04
  • 香港服务器适合部署哪些行业呢

    香港服务器适合部署哪些行业香港服务器作为亚洲地区的重要数据中心,拥有良好的网络基础设施和稳定的电力供应,因此在很多行业中都得到了广泛的应用,以下是香港服务器适合部署的一些主要行业:1、金融行业金融行业对于数据的安全性和稳定性要求非常高,香港服务器凭借其优越的地理位置和良好的网络环境,成为了金融行业的理想选择,香港交易所、证券公司、银行……

    2024-01-11
    0103
  • 华为stk al00什么型号

    华为STK-AL00是华为公司推出的一款入门级智能手机,主要面向年轻用户和初次接触智能手机的用户群体,这款手机在性能和特点方面具有一定的竞争力,但与市面上的高端旗舰机型相比,仍有一定的差距,下面我们来详细了解一下华为STK-AL00的性能和特点。1. 外观设计华为STK-AL00采用了简约时尚的设计风格,机身线条流畅,手感舒适,手机正……

    2023-12-08
    0246

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入